The CBI has been directed by the AP High Court on Wednesday to conduct a probe into alleged transgressions in the management-quota MBBS admissions at the Apollo Institute of Medical Sciences and Research in Jubilee Hills.
While a division bench ruled that 34 candidates were not to be allowed to pursue their MBBS at Apollo - as they did not meet the criteria, it also ordered the NTR Health University and the Medical Council of India (MCI) to nullify all permissions and affiliations to Apollo, and to take severe action against the college for the breach MCI's regulations.
The 34 students were said to have been given admissions in preference to 40 other students who allegedly scored better.
